Sustainable Biomaterials: Current Trends, Challenges and Applications

Molecules. 2015 Dec 30;21(1):E48. doi: 10.3390/molecules21010048.

Abstract

Biomaterials and sustainable resources are two complementary terms supporting the development of new sustainable emerging processes. In this context, many interdisciplinary approaches including biomass waste valorization and proper usage of green technologies, etc., were brought forward to tackle future challenges pertaining to declining fossil resources, energy conservation, and related environmental issues. The implementation of these approaches impels its potential effect on the economy of particular countries and also reduces unnecessary overburden on the environment. This contribution aims to provide an overview of some of the most recent trends, challenges, and applications in the field of biomaterials derived from sustainable resources.

Keywords: biomass precursors; bioplastics; porous carbons; sustainable biomaterials; waste valorization.
